What Is A Hospital Wheelchair?

A hospital wheelchair is a specialized mobility device designed for the safe and comfortable transport of patients within healthcare facilities. Unlike standard wheelchairs, hospital models incorporate specific features to meet the demanding clinical environment, prioritizing patient stability, ease of maneuverability for caregivers, and hygiene. They are constructed from durable, medical-grade materials that can withstand frequent cleaning and disinfection, crucial for infection control in a Sudanese healthcare setting. The primary function of a hospital wheelchair is to provide temporary or long-term mobility solutions for individuals who are unable to walk or ambulate independently due to illness, injury, or post-operative recovery.

Key clinical applications in Sudan include facilitating patient movement between wards, examination rooms, diagnostic imaging suites (such as X-ray or ultrasound), operating theaters, and to and from transportation vehicles. They are essential for patients undergoing physical therapy, rehabilitation, or requiring assistance with personal care. Furthermore, hospital wheelchairs are vital for managing patient flow in busy clinics and ensuring the timely transfer of individuals needing urgent medical attention.

Clinical ScenarioWheelchair Application
Post-operative recoverySafe transport from recovery room to ward.
Diagnostic imagingMovement to and from X-ray, CT, or MRI suites.
Emergency departmentRapid patient triage and movement to examination bays.
Outpatient clinicsFacilitating patient access to consultation rooms and waiting areas.
Rehabilitation servicesAssisting patients during therapy sessions and transfers.

Key Components and Features:

  • Robust frame construction for patient weight support and durability.
  • Locking castor wheels for secure patient transfers and stable positioning.
  • Padded seats and backrests for patient comfort during transport.
  • Swing-away or removable legrests and armrests for improved accessibility and transfers.
  • Foldable design for efficient storage and transport within ambulances or facility corridors.
  • Hygienic, easily cleanable surfaces to maintain infection control standards.

How Much Is A Hospital Wheelchair In Sudan?

The cost of a hospital wheelchair in Sudan can vary significantly based on several factors, including the type of wheelchair, its features, brand, and whether it is brand new or refurbished. For businesses and healthcare facilities in Sudan, understanding these price ranges is crucial for budgeting and procurement.

Generally, you can expect to find brand new, standard hospital wheelchairs ranging from approximately 400,000 SDG to 1,500,000 SDG. More advanced models with specialized features, such as adjustable backrests, elevated leg rests, or bariatric capacity, can command higher prices, potentially exceeding 2,000,000 SDG. Prices are influenced by import costs, shipping, and the specific distributor.

Refurbished hospital wheelchairs offer a more budget-friendly option for Sudanese institutions. These pre-owned units, often sourced internationally and professionally restored, typically fall within a price range of 150,000 SDG to 700,000 SDG. While these can provide significant cost savings, it's essential to ensure that refurbishment is done to a high standard, guaranteeing functionality and safety.

Wheelchair TypeEstimated Price Range (Sudanese Pound - SDG)
Standard New Hospital Wheelchair400,000 - 1,500,000 SDG
Advanced/Specialized New Wheelchair1,000,000 - 2,500,000+ SDG
Refurbished Standard Hospital Wheelchair150,000 - 700,000 SDG

Factors Influencing Wheelchair Price in Sudan:

  • New vs. Refurbished Condition
  • Material and Build Quality (e.g., steel vs. lightweight aluminum)
  • Specific Features (e.g., reclining, attendant-controlled brakes, padded upholstery)
  • Brand Reputation and Origin
  • Additional Accessories (e.g., cushions, trays)
  • Supplier and Import Costs
